我是java脚本的新手。我搜索了一种方法来单击UpdatePanel内部的按钮以清除位于UpdatePanel外部的TextBox。并找到这个工作正常的代码。但我想知道如何获得javascript代码?这是代码(VB.NET):
ScriptManager.RegisterStartupScript(Me.Page, Me.Page.[GetType](), "myScript", "document.getElementById('" + TextBox2.ClientID & "').value = '';", True)
问题:我知道javascript运行客户端,但Asp.net是服务器端。如果我在页面中使用上述代码会怎样?
答案 0 :(得分:0)
为了在客户端使用JavaScript做这件事你可以做这样的事情 -
<script>
function clearText(){
document.getElementById("<%=TextBox2.ClientID%>").value = '';
}
</script>
在buttton的ClientClick
事件中调用上述函数。希望这能解决你的问题。